Abstract
We present updated results on time-dependent asymmetries in fully reconstructed and decays in approximately events collected with the BABAR detector at the PEP-II asymmetric-energy factory at SLAC. From a time-dependent maximum-likelihood fit we obtain for the parameters related to the violation angle : , , , ,, , where the first error is statistical and the second is systematic. Using other measurements and theoretical assumptions, we interpret the results in terms of the angles of the Cabibbo-Kobayashi-Maskawa unitarity triangle and find at 68% (90%) confidence level.
